Over 100 years ago the editors in the new rooms used to have a large spike (something from the old cowboy days like an old railroad spike) on the wall next to the editors desk.
The reporters had to place their news story’s on the desk of the editor and he would OK it, revise it, rewrite it, and if the editor did NOT want the story published, or broadcast or on the wire, he would put it on the -” “SPIKE” “- and everyone knew that this story was -SPIKED- and if anyone dare put this story out he was -FIRED- and may also be BLACK BALLED from the profession!!!
